Smoke bombs are popular for photography, videography, and events such as weddings, sports games, festivals, and celebrations. They add vibrant color and atmosphere, creating unique visuals.
Yes, our smoke bombs are designed with safety in mind and comply with all safety standards. They are non-toxic, but we recommend using them outdoors and keeping them away from flammable materials.
The smoke duration varies by model but typically lasts up to 90 seconds. Each product page includes details about smoke duration to help you choose the right one.
Our smoke bombs are designed to produce minimal residue, and we are committed to eco-friendly practices. However, we recommend using them responsibly and disposing of any remnants properly.
While the smoke itself is non-staining, close contact with the device or hot smoke can leave marks. We recommend using smoke bombs at a safe distance from people and surfaces.
Smoke bombs are classified as pyrotechnics, so they are generally prohibited on airplanes and public transportation. Check local regulations before traveling with them.
Store smoke bombs in a cool, dry place, away from direct sunlight or heat sources. Keep them out of reach of children and pets.
